John Raskin |
John Raskin began working with ACT when he founded Democracy in the Park, an all-volunteer organization whose members gathered in public parks around the country during the 2004 election season and used their free weekend cell phone minutes to call voters in swing states. John works as a community organizer for Housing Conservation Coordinators, a non-profit affordable housing advocacy group, and has organized neighborhood campaigns to win affordable housing commitments, protect tenants whose apartments are threatened, and defeat the proposed West Side Stadium. John’s film credits include “Himself” in a surprising number of independent documentaries about grass-roots organizing in Manhattan; he is quickly discovering that in a town filled with aspiring filmmakers, one cannot swing a cat around a lefty organizing campaign without ending up in somebody’s new documentary. |
